It's a complete **** to get to - it's buried in between the dash and the transmission tunnel. The only way to get to it is by dropping the transmission or pulling the entire dash out. Which is why this alternative fix is quite attractive to those who suffer the problem.

The 5.0 models have a modified 'duck bill' with most of one side cut away, thus reducing the chance that the two sides will stick together and block the tube. It could still happen, but it's considerably less likely.

Premium sound has an active top center dash speaker. Premium sound also has 2 speakers on each door, back seat side speakers, center dash top speaker and sub woofer and "remote" 525 watt amplifier in passenger footwell. Premium sound has 8 speakers total. Basic stereo system has the 4 door speakers and 2 back side speakers for a total of 6 speakers. No passenger footwell speaker/amplifier.
